Summary
A Native Canadian sheath made from kid leather with applied panel of red felt decorated with blue, pink and green glass beads, and embroidered along the braided edges. Collected Yukon 1902 (1907?). Part of Lord Egerton's collection of ethnographic objects once displayed in the Tenants' Hall.
